Ramp from S.R. 912 north to U.S. 20 east closed during resurface construction

Closure scheduled for daylight hours tomorrow

GARY, Ind. - The Indiana Department of Transportation (INDOT) announces the ramp from northbound State Road 912 (Cline Avenue) to eastbound U.S. 20 in Gary will be closed during the daylight hours Sept. 3 during resurface construction. Posted signs will direct traffic around the closure via the other Cline/U.S. 20 interchange ramps.

This work is in relation to the $1.8 million resurface construction project on U.S. 20 between Cline and Bridge Street in Lake County. Construction began in July and is scheduled for completion in October 2008.
